
Asiapower Overseas | E-Showroom
Asiapower Overseas | E-Showroom
Asiapower Overseas
204, 2nd Floor, Bezzola Commercial.Complex
Sion Trombay Road, Opp.Suman Nagar
Chembur
Phone
0091 22 25230262
Mobile
Email